Description

Support is used in waterproof engineering construction
Technical Field
The utility model relates to an engineering construction auxiliary device technical field especially relates to a support is used in waterproof engineering construction.
Background
The waterproof engineering is a system engineering, and relates to various aspects of waterproof materials, waterproof engineering design, construction technology, building management and the like. The purpose is to ensure that the building is not eroded by water, the internal space is not damaged, the use function and the production and living quality of the building are improved, and the living environment is improved. The waterproof engineering categories include roofing waterproofing, basement waterproofing, toilet waterproofing, exterior wall waterproofing, and subway waterproofing.
The workman need use the support when carrying out waterproof engineering construction, and current support generally sets up work platform for setting up on the scaffold frame of setting up, and the workman stands and is under construction on work platform. However, the above-mentioned support is fixed to be set up, and the scaffold process of setting up is loaded down with trivial details, need set up the waterproof construction in order to support not co-altitude place region of a plurality of not co-altitude work platforms, and it is not good to use the flexibility.

Detailed Description
In order to make the objects, technical solutions and advantages of the present invention more apparent, the present invention will be described in detail with reference to the accompanying drawings. It should be understood that the description is intended to be illustrative only and is not intended to limit the scope of the present invention. Moreover, in the following description, descriptions of well-known structures and techniques are omitted so as to not unnecessarily obscure the concepts of the present invention.
As shown in fig. 1-2, the utility model provides a support for waterproof engineering construction, including leading truck 1, first link 2, support frame 3, second link 4, foot cup 5, first mounting bracket 6, walking wheel 7, first drive arrangement 8, gear 9, rack 10, second mounting bracket 11, mounting panel 12, first guide bar 13, mobile station 14, rings 15, cable 16, leading wheel 17, wind-up wheel 18 and second drive arrangement 19;
the guide frame 1 is arranged along the transverse direction, the guide groove 101 is arranged on the guide frame 1, and two guide frames 1 are arranged side by side along the longitudinal direction; two first connecting frames 2 are arranged side by side along the transverse direction and are respectively connected with the two transverse ends of the two guide frames 1; the support frame 3 is longitudinally arranged at the bottom of the guide frame 1, and a plurality of support frames are arranged side by side along the transverse direction; the second connecting frame 4 is arranged on the support frame 3 along the transverse direction; the foot cup 5 is arranged at the bottom of the support frame 3; the second driving device 19 is arranged at the top of the mounting plate 12 and is in transmission connection with the winding wheel 18; the guide wheel 17 is arranged on the top of the mounting plate 12; the inhaul cable 16 penetrates through the guide wheel 17, and two ends of the inhaul cable are respectively connected with the winding wheel 18 and the hanging ring 15; the hanging ring 15 is arranged on the mobile station 14; the mobile station 14 is connected with the first guide rod 13 in a sliding way; a plurality of first guide rods 13 are arranged side by side, the top parts of the first guide rods are connected with the mounting plate 12, and the bottom parts of the first guide rods are connected with the first mounting frame 6; the first driving device 8 is arranged on the first mounting frame 6 and is in transmission connection with the gear 9; the gear 9 is meshed with the rack 10; the rack 10 is horizontally arranged on the first connecting frame 2; the walking wheels 7 are arranged on the first mounting frame 6, and the walking wheels 7 are positioned in the guide grooves 101 and are in rolling connection with the guide frame 1.
The utility model discloses in, the workman removes this support to the construction area, fix through foot cup 5, the workman stands on mobile station 14, output drive winding wheel 18 of second drive arrangement 19 rotates, 18 rolling cables 16 of winding wheel, 16 drive rings 15 of cable and mobile station 14 remove, first guide bar 13 is used for leading to the moving direction of mobile station 14, make mobile station 14 remove along vertical direction to make the workman carry out the waterproof construction on the vertical region. The output end of the first driving device 8 drives the gear 9 to rotate, the gear 9 rolls on the rack 10, and the walking wheels 7 roll in the guide groove 101, so that the first driving device 8, the first mounting frame 6, the second mounting frame 11 and the mobile station 14 move in the transverse direction, and a worker can conveniently perform waterproof construction on a horizontal area. The utility model discloses make the mobile station 14 that the workman stood can remove along horizontal and vertical direction, improved the convenience and the flexibility that the workman carried out the waterproof engineering construction.
In an alternative embodiment, a second guide bar 23 is connected between the two first connecting frames 2; the second guide rod 23 is arranged side by side with the rack 10; the bottom of the first mounting frame 6 is provided with a guide table 24; the guide table 24 is slidably connected to the second guide bar 23.
It should be noted that the second guide bar 23 is used for guiding the moving direction of the guide table 24, so that the guide table 24 moves in the horizontal direction, and thus the first mounting frame 6 moves in the horizontal direction, and the process of moving the second mounting frame 11 and the moving table 14 in the transverse direction is more stable.
In an alternative embodiment, the guide frame 1 is provided with cushion pads 25 at both lateral ends; the cushion pad 25 is located in the guide groove 101.
It should be noted that, when the walking wheel 7 moves to the two ends of the guide groove 101 along the transverse direction, the buffer pad 25 is used for isolating the walking wheel 7 from the first connecting frame 2 and buffering the impact of the walking wheel 7 on the first connecting frame 2, so as to reduce the noise in use and the loss caused by the impact between the parts.
In an alternative embodiment, the first mounting bracket 6 and the second mounting bracket 11 are provided with reinforcing ribs 20.
It should be noted that, by providing the reinforcing rib plate 20, the structural strength of the first mounting frame 6 and the second mounting frame 11 is improved, and the stability of the bracket is further improved.
In an alternative embodiment, a guard rail 22 is provided on the mobile station 14.
It should be noted that, the worker stands on the mobile station 14 for construction, the guardrail 22 can protect the worker and prevent the worker from falling off the mobile station 14, and the safety of the support frame is improved by the guardrail 22.
In an alternative embodiment, the first mounting frame 6 is provided with a protective cover 21; the first drive means 8 are located inside the protective cover 21.
It should be noted that the protection cover 21 is provided to protect the first driving device 8, so as to prevent dust on the construction site from entering the first driving device 8 and affecting the normal operation thereof.
